The weather turned out better than expected today so of course I had to ride.
About 5mi out of town on 2 lane county rd, I'm cruising @ 60mph and a freakin deer jumps outa the ditch and runs out in front of me
I hit both brakes, locked the rear, I heard it screeching and just about got sideways with a little wobble prolly still doing 45mph ,the deer cleared my path just in time to release the brakes and get under control, I think I was a split second from either tumbling or impacting the deer
Stay alert out there if you live in deer country , I'd a probley hit it if I hadn't seen it a little before it got to the road.
